Excerpt from List of Proceedings in the Court of Requests, Preserved in the Public Record Office, Vol. 1 In the latter years of Elizabeth, the Court of Requests came into repeated conflict with the Court of Common Pleas; and in Michaelmas term, 40-41 Eliz., the latter court decided in the case of Stepney v. Floud that the Court of Requests had no power to issue warrants for arrest under the Privy Seal. This blow, however, was not destructive; for the Court of Requests continued to do abundant business till the outbreak of the Civil War. Excerpt from Select Civil Pleas, Vol. 1 King's Court seems to have been instituted in the reign of Henry II., but no Rolls of that period are known. In case 155 in this volume, the defendants put themselves on the rolls of the first year of the reign of King Richard. No rolls are known to be extant for so early a year, but it is quite possible that there are such among the rolls of uncertain date. Most of these could, I believe, be accurately dated with the aid of the Feet of Fines, but until these last are all printed and indexed, it is hopeless to make the attempt. In this way I have ascertained Curia Regis Roll, No. 67 (late Coram Rege Roll, John, No. Which is undated, to be of Hilary Term in the fifth year. Several rolls of Richard's reign have been identified during the recent examination and rearrangement of the Coram Rege Rolls, though none of them are of very early date. Nos. 5, 53, 55, 66 (in. 2 only) and 69 (old numbers) have now been transferred to this reign, and these, it is understood, are to be included in the Publications of the Pipe Roll Society.
